I have recently acquired an Atom 3.0 and notice that in both the PC and Mac software for loading dives from the PDC the start and end times of the dives only include hh:mm and not the seconds. For a basic log that is perfectly fine, however, I like to synchronise my camera with the PDC so I can determine the depth that a photo was taken. I currently have this all automated with my previous computer (Citizen Cyber Aqualand NX) so it is very simple. I will automate it with the Atom 3.0, but not being able to get the seconds portion of the dive start time means I can only get accurate to the nearest minute - and the depth can change quite a lot in a minute.

I'm guessing it is probably not available but if it is, one of you good people would know how to get it.
